Output 89abc1c93515791513cc6f72a31409b2b3169807c86171b8f70e22f52b14a5e3:2

value
9624976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ab247829473e2959753f89bff4bfbf551abde91c OP_EQUAL
address
MPW5UApZ7HyQEy1UG9DjSPupmeFpvttPCg
transaction
89abc1c93515791513cc6f72a31409b2b3169807c86171b8f70e22f52b14a5e3
spent
true